Nobel Laureate, Professor Wole Soyinka, has asked the Buhari Admnistration to respond positively to the crisis in the Niger Delta Region to restore peace to the region.
Addressing a news conference in Lagos, he said the expected response from the presidency should be holistic and comprehensive.
Soyinka said his recent visit to president Buhari at the Presidential Villa, Abuja, followed requests by some militants who want him to intervene in the crisis.
Refuting reports that he was part of an international effort to resolve the crisis, he said he was contacted to intervene personally and he has been reporting to his contacts personally.
